Clarify Intention Behind Each Synonym
Selecting a change agent synonym should reflect the scope and urgency of the work. A catalyst implies quick ignition, while a transformation leader suggests deeper, longer term involvement.
Match the title to the audience and the change maturity level. Teams respond better to roles that signal both authority and support, so choose language that balances influence with collaboration.

How do I choose among the available change agent synonym options?
Start with the scale and complexity of the change. Use catalyst or improvement champion for targeted initiatives, and transformation leader for enterprise level shifts that require sustained capability.
